在数字化时代,网页应用已经成为人们日常生活中不可或缺的一部分。而高效、易用的网页应用,则能为企业带来更多的用户和更高的价值。那么,如何用流程设计前端框架轻松打造高效网页应用呢?本文将从以下几个方面进行探讨。
一、了解前端框架
首先,我们需要了解前端框架的概念。前端框架是一种为了提高开发效率、规范代码结构和实现特定功能的工具。目前,主流的前端框架有React、Vue、Angular等。这些框架都提供了一套完整的解决方案,包括组件库、路由管理、状态管理等。
二、流程设计的重要性
流程设计是前端开发中不可或缺的一环。一个良好的流程设计,可以使开发过程更加高效、有序。以下是流程设计在打造高效网页应用中的重要性:
- 提高开发效率:合理的流程设计可以减少重复劳动,提高开发效率。
- 降低出错率:清晰的流程可以避免因理解错误而导致的代码错误。
- 便于团队协作:良好的流程设计有助于团队成员之间的沟通和协作。
三、流程设计步骤
以下是使用前端框架打造高效网页应用的流程设计步骤:
1. 需求分析
在开始设计流程之前,首先要明确项目的需求。这包括功能需求、性能需求、用户体验需求等。通过需求分析,我们可以确定项目的核心功能和目标用户。
2. 技术选型
根据需求分析的结果,选择合适的前端框架。在选择框架时,要考虑以下因素:
- 易用性:框架是否易于学习和使用。
- 生态圈:框架是否有丰富的插件和组件。
- 性能:框架的性能是否满足项目需求。
3. 组件设计
组件是前端框架的核心组成部分。在设计组件时,要遵循以下原则:
- 模块化:将功能划分为独立的模块,便于管理和复用。
- 复用性:设计可复用的组件,提高开发效率。
- 可维护性:组件的代码结构要清晰,便于维护。
4. 路由管理
路由管理负责处理页面跳转和组件渲染。在设计路由时,要考虑以下因素:
- 清晰的路由结构:使页面跳转更加直观。
- 动态路由:支持动态参数的路由。
- 路由守卫:实现权限控制。
5. 状态管理
状态管理负责管理应用的状态。在设计状态管理时,要考虑以下因素:
- 数据流:确保数据流的清晰和可预测。
- 可维护性:使状态管理更加易于维护。
- 性能优化:减少不必要的渲染。
6. 优化性能
性能优化是打造高效网页应用的关键。以下是一些性能优化的方法:
- 代码压缩:减少代码体积,提高加载速度。
- 懒加载:按需加载组件,减少初始加载时间。
- 缓存:利用缓存技术,提高页面访问速度。
7. 测试与部署
在完成开发后,要进行充分的测试,确保应用的稳定性和可靠性。测试完成后,将应用部署到服务器上,供用户使用。
四、总结
通过以上步骤,我们可以使用流程设计前端框架轻松打造高效网页应用。在这个过程中,要注重需求分析、技术选型、组件设计、路由管理、状态管理、性能优化和测试与部署等环节。只有将这些环节做到位,才能打造出真正高效、易用的网页应用。
